What is a Cryptocurrency Casino?

A cryptocurrency casino is an online gambling platform that accepts digital currencies for deposits, withdrawals, and gameplay. Unlike conventional online gambling establishments that depend on fiat currencies (GBP, EUR, GBP) and conventional banking systems, crypto casinos make use of the speed, security, and anonymity of blockchain innovation.

While some platforms serve as "hybrid" websites-- accepting both fiat and crypto--"crypto-native" gambling establishments operate solely on the blockchain, typically moving far from traditional KYC (Know Your Customer) processes to prioritize user privacy.

2. Provably Fair Technology

One of the most ingenious functions of the blockchain-based betting sector is "Provably Fair" video gaming. This innovation enables players to verify the randomness and fairness of every hand, spin, or dice roll utilizing cryptographic hashes. Rather of depending on a third-party audit, players can confirm that the casino has not controlled the chances.

Considerations and Risks

While the advantages are significant, players should approach crypto gambling establishments with care. The decentralized nature of these platforms indicates that users bear more personal duty.

Essential Checklist for Players:

  • Licensing and Regulation: Always inspect if the casino holds a license from a trustworthy jurisdiction (e.g., Curacao, Malta).
  • Security: Utilize a cold-storage wallet for your funds and never ever keep large balances on an exchange or casino account longer than needed.
  • Volatility: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ies can be highly unpredictable. A bankroll can change in value considerably during a gaming session.
  • Accountable Gambling: Digital possessions can make it seem like "play cash." It is vital to set strict limits on time and budget.
